She’s served us well, now it’s our turn to help her.

Memorial Arena has stood the test of time for 66 years, and we have the opportunity through the Kraft Hockeyville contest to receive a $100,000 upgrade for the venerable barn on Tweedsmuir.

Chatham has already cracked the top 10 in the Kraft Hockeyville contest, but now we need more online votes from March 21-23 to make it to the final two. If successful, we will end up in the championship round the following week.

It’s not as if local residents haven’t been down this road before. We landed Boardwalk in the Canadian Monopoly game in 2010. And a year later, Wallaceburg placed in the top 10 in the Kraft Celebration Tour.

There have been various ideas and plans put forth to replace Memorial for the past two decades, but for any number of reasons they haven’t come to pass.

Municipal staff have done an amazing job keeping the arena running as well as it has.

It could serve as a movie backdrop of a 1950s-style arena, but the reality is, age eventually catches up to everyone and everything.

There is a time when quaint just won’t cut it anymore and that time is drawing closer each season.

The arena has hosted Canadian championships in hockey, helped launch the careers of several National Hockey League players and world-class figure skaters, was home to ball hockey in the summer, and has served as a longtime Red Feather and Jaycee Fair headquarters, as well as more events than can be listed.

In addition to the cash, the winning community will host an NHL exhibition game next year. It would be a wonderful way to give the building one more night of glory before she gets the rest she’s earned.
